Advanced Certificate in Clinical Translational Investigation is a one-year program consisting of a multidisciplinary core competency-based curriculum (a total of 12 courses, 22 course credits). Upon completion of the core didactic program, trainees receive an Advanced Certificate in Clinical Investigation. The core curriculum begins in the fall term and includes, in addition to coursework, seminars and workshops in ethical, social, and legal issues of responsible clinical research, and seminars in grant writing and interactions with industry.
